Welcome to Orlando, Florida, where world-class theme parks and sunny skies come together to create the perfect student trip. At the heart of it all is Walt Disney World Resort, home to four spectacular parks: Magic Kingdom, where you can watch fireworks over Cinderella’s Castle; Epcot, where you can explore 11 countries in one afternoon and fly over the world on Soarin’; Hollywood Studios, where Star Wars fans can pilot the Millennium Falcon and Toy Story lovers can shrink down to size in Andy’s backyard; and Animal Kingdom, where real-life safari animals and the floating mountains of Pandora coexist. Group Dining
- Planet Hollywood (Disney Springs) – Celebrity memorabilia and group menus
- Hard Rock Cafe (Universal CityWalk) – Music-themed dining in a massive venue
- Rainforest Cafe (Disney Springs) – A fun themed environment
- Be Our Guest Restaurant (Magic Kingdom) – Dine in the Beast’s enchanted castle with French-inspired cuisine and dramatic castle decor
- Chef Mickey’s (Disney’s Contemporary Resort) – Character dining with Mickey and friends—great buffet and great for kids and big groups
- The Boathouse (Disney Springs) – Upscale waterfront dining with fresh seafood, private dockside seating, and Amphicar tours
- Raglan Road Irish Pub (Disney Springs) – Live Irish music and dancing, a lively pub atmosphere, and group seating indoors and out
- Toothsome Chocolate Emporium (Universal CityWalk) – Themed restaurant with over-the-top milkshakes, pastas, and gourmet burgers
- Margaritaville (Universal CityWalk) – Laid-back Jimmy Buffett vibe with Caribbean food, tropical drinks, and space for large parties
Shopping
- Disney Springs – Souvenirs, shops and group-friendly restaurants
- Universal CityWalk – Shopping and entertainment in one place
- Orlando Premium Outlets – Discounted fashion and brand-name deals
- The Mall at Millenia – High-end shopping with luxury brands and stylish restaurants
- Orlando Vineland Premium Outlets – A more upscale outlet experience
- The Florida Mall – Orlando’s largest indoor mall with over 250 stores, including Apple, Zara, H&M and an attached Crayola Experience.
- Lake Buena Vista Factory Stores – A smaller, quieter outlet option close to Disney with brands like Nike, Tommy Hilfiger and Levi’s; often less crowded than the Premium Outlets
